Instalación de Windows Server utilizando el entorno de ejecución previa al arranque (PXE)

Introducción

La instalación de Windows Server a través del entorno de ejecución previa al arranque (PXE) es una técnica poderosa para implementar sistemas operativos en entornos donde el uso de medios físicos es poco práctico. Especialmente útil en configuraciones de red extensa o para empresas con múltiples servidores, esta guía detallará los pasos necesarios para configurar, implementar y administrar la instalación de Windows Server utilizando PXE.

Versiones de Windows Server Compatibles

Las versiones de Windows Server que son compatibles con la instalación PXE incluyen:

  • Windows Server 2012/2012 R2
  • Windows Server 2016
  • Windows Server 2019
  • Windows Server 2022

Diferencias Significativas:

  • Windows Server 2016 y superiores introducen características adicionales como mejoras en la funcionalidad de Hyper-V y nuevas herramientas de administración, que pueden facilitar la instalación y gestión del entorno PXE.
  • Windows Server 2022 ofrece capacidades de seguridad refinadas y mayores funcionalidades en la gestión del almacenamiento.

Pasos para Configurar PXE en Windows Server

1. Preparativos Iniciales

  • Red: Asegúrate de tener DHCP y DNS configurados en tu red.
  • Servidores: Tendrás que instalar un servidor Windows que actuará como fuente de PXE.

2. Configuración del Servidor DHCP

  1. Abre el Gestor del Servidor y agrega la función Servicio de DHCP.
  2. Configura el ámbito DHCP:

    • Establece un rango de direcciones IP.
    • Asegúrate de habilitar las opciones necesarias:

      • Opción 66: Dirección del servidor TFTP (el servidor donde reside la imagen de instalación).
      • Opción 67: Nombre del archivo de arrancado (ejemplo: boot\x64\wdsnbp.com para arquitecturas x64).

3. Instalación de Windows Deployment Services (WDS)

  1. En el Gestor del Servidor, selecciona Agregar funciones y características y luego instala Windows Deployment Services.
  2. Configura WDS a través del asistente:

    • Selecciona la opción para instalar en modo integrado.
    • Configura la ubicación de los archivos de captura y los bibliotecas de transporte.

4. Agregar Imágenes de Instalación

  1. Abre la consola de Windows Deployment Services.
  2. Haz clic derecho en Imágenes de arranque y elige agregar una imagen de arranque (el archivo .wim que descargaste del medio de instalación de Windows Server).
  3. Haz lo mismo para Imágenes de instalación, seleccionando la imagen que deseas desplegar.

5. Habilitar y Probar PXE

  • Asegúrate de que las configuraciones de firewall permitan el tráfico en los puertos necesarios (UDP 67 y 69).
  • Reinicia el cliente en la red y configura el BIOS/UEFI para arrancar desde PXE.
  • Observa el proceso de arranque hasta llegar al menú de instalación de Windows.

Seguridad en el Entorno PXE

  • Aislamiento de red: Considera implementar VLANs o subredes para el tráfico PXE.
  • Autenticación: Implementa métodos de autorización para limitar qué dispositivos pueden usar el servidor PXE.
  • Actualizaciones: Mantén el software del servidor WDS y los sistemas operativos actualizados y aplica los parches necesarios para evitar vulnerabilidades.

Errores Comunes y Soluciones

1. No se obtiene dirección IP

  • Causa: Errores en la configuración DHCP.
  • Solución: Verifica que el servidor DHCP esté funcionando correctamente y que las opciones están configuradas.

2. Error al cargar el archivo de imagen

  • Causa: El archivo imagen no está disponible o hay errores en la ruta de archivo.
  • Solución: Confirma que el archivo esté en la ubicación correcta y revise el nombre del archivo en la configuración del servidor.

3. Timeout en el arranque PXE

  • Causa: Problemas de red o de carga en el servidor.
  • Solución: Asegúrate de que el servidor WDS esté activo y verifica la conectividad de red.

Mejores Prácticas y Estrategias de Optimización

  • Monitoreo de recursos: Usa herramientas como Performance Monitor para trackear el uso de recursos en el servidor PXE y optimiza según sea necesario.
  • Configuración avanzada: Implementa capturas de imágenes personalizadas utilizando Windows System Image Manager (WSIM) para aprovechar al máximo las configuraciones automatizadas en la instalación.

Impacto en la Administracion de Recursos y Escalabilidad

Implementaciones utilizando WDS y PXE permiten una administración más eficiente de múltiples servidores. Automatiza los despliegues y reduce el tiempo necesario para la configuración manual. En entornos grandes, esto también se traduce en una mejor escalabilidad; la capacidad de desplegar numerosas instalaciones a la vez permite un crecimiento más ágil de la infraestructura IT.

FAQ

  1. ¿Qué pasos son necesarios para solucionar el error "no se puede encontrar el servidor TFTP"?

    • Verifica la configuración DHCP. Asegúrate de que la Opción 66 permita la dirección IP del servidor donde está WDS.

  2. ¿Cómo puedo hacer una imagen personalizada en PXE?

    • Usa WSIM para crear un archivo de respuesta que ajuste las configuraciones y luego captura la imagen del sistema operativo para usarla en el despliegue.

  3. ¿Cuáles son las diferencias en la implementación de PXE en Windows Server 2019 comparado con 2016?

    • Windows Server 2019 presenta mejoras en la integración con Azure y la administración simplificada a través de PowerShell.

  4. ¿Qué configuraciones recomiendas para aumentar la seguridad de PXE en una red grande?

    • Implementa VLANs, configura credenciales de acceso en el servidor PXE y limita el acceso al servidor WDS mediante ACLs (Listas de Control de Acceso).

  5. ¿Cómo puedo automatizar la instalación de software adicional después de la implementación de Windows Server a través de PXE?

    • Utiliza scripts de PowerShell o herramientas como System Center Configuration Manager (SCCM) para desplegar software automáticamente tras la imagen base.

  6. ¿Qué errores comunes de conexión de red puedo encontrar?

    • Verifica que todos los cables y conexiones estén operativos. Prueba proporcionar un ipconfig desde un console de CMD para verificar todas las configuraciones correctas.

  7. ¿Es necesario usar certificados para el entorno PXE?

    • En entornos más seguros, utilizar certificados SSL/TLS es recomendable para asegurar el tráfico entre el servidor.

  8. ¿Puedo realizar capturas de imágenes de servidores Windows que tienen roles y funciones específicos?

    • Sí, pero asegúrate de que cualquier hardware o controladores específicos estén empaquetados junto con la imagen para evitar problemas al iniciar.

  9. Si tengo problemas de rendimiento en ejecuciones PXE, ¿cuáles serían las causas comunes?

    • Problemas de ancho de banda, configuraciones inadecuadas de los servidores WDS/DHCP o recursos insuficientes en el servidor PXE.

  10. ¿Cómo puedo gestionar un entorno de gran tamaño a través de PXE?

    • Considera implementar un diseño jerárquico donde posters varios servidores PXE en diferentes lugares para balancear la carga de tráfico y facilitar la administración.

Conclusión

La instalación de Windows Server a través de PXE es una estrategia eficaz que ofrece automatización, escalabilidad y facilidad de administración, especialmente en entornos empresariales. A través de una correcta configuración de DHCP, WDS, y medidas de seguridad, las organizaciones pueden optimizar su infraestructura tecnológica. Sin embargo, es vital resolver errores comunes y aplicar mejores prácticas para asegurar una implementación exitosa.

Deja un comentario